it's always a bit surprising when people comment on my fics that they like that i write henry so confident or that they could recognise my writing by the way i write him. obviously there's plenty of ways you can play him. but he comes across to me as a very confident guy. the actions you have no control over alone: he does not take shit laying down and he goes for what he wants. from kcd1 to kcd2 that's always a key component of his personality. not a lot flusters him.

Do you think Warhorse was trying to retcon Istvan and Erik's relationship in the second game? By making Erik visually older (like they did with Henry and Hans, specifically noting in the codex that they are 20), and their interactions with each other so normal that people who haven't played the first game might even think that it's just a regular relationship with an age difference.
Or was it their intention from the start to show that despite how fucked up isterik relationship is, they genuinely love and care for each other? Maybe I'm wrong, because I still can't believe that a studio whose first game was aimed at a "straight white male gamer" managed to show such a complex and nuanced gay relationship.
no, I don’t see why they would. they doubled down on the nature of their relationship in 2, even having istvan tell erik that he’s grown into a very capable young man etc etc etc… im not gonna go over every single interaction, but the depth and circumstances were explored and if warhorse wanted to take that back they could’ve. their relationship is obvious and erik’s appearance doesn’t distract from the questionable nature of it.
I think his appearance doesn’t get any deeper than just being based off his eng actor’s appearance - same w henry and hans. some people just look older/younger for their age, and trauma can especially age a person, so it makes sense for erik in that case. it could be an easy excuse to try and make their relationship less jarring, sure, but I find that unlikely. he doesn’t have to look like a little boy to get the point across.
it's the latter, hard as it is to believe, bc it’s really to do w the fact that they’re written as people first, not Gay Villains - just as hansry were written with so much depth that even if you don’t romance hans they remain strong characters. everything abt isterik is intentional, just as this game tries to show the humanity in everything. it is intentionally wrong, it is intentionally fucked up, but they saved each other and that’s all that matters to them.
